About the role
Collaborate with stakeholders to turn information into actionable insights that drive business growth.
Lead a variety of data and intelligence projects, across multiple complex areas, to include lease and maintenance optimisation.
Design, build and optimise Azure-based data environments, integrations, and pipelines.
Create and maintain impactful dashboards and reports across tools like Power BI and SSRS.
Enhance database performance through optimised SQL queries and stored procedures.
Analyse and manipulate data using SQL, Power BI, Python, and R to uncover trends and support decisions.
Provide technical leadership in data engineering, ensuring scalable, secure, and sustainable solutions.
Mentor and support team members, encouraging collaboration, innovation, and continuous learning.
Develop secure, self-service frameworks that empower users with access to reliable data.
Document systems and processes, stay ahead of emerging technologies, and contribute to wider IT projects.
